## Summary

The public procurement process led by NHS Midlands & Lancashire Commissioning Support Unit has concluded with the award for a Digital Project Consultancy, focusing on reforms to imaging and pathology services in England. The procurement targeted project management consultancy services under CPV classification 72224000, aiming to enhance quality, optimise workforce productivity, and reduce service variations. The award was announced on 5 August 2025, with the project's contract period starting on 12 August 2025 and ending on 31 March 2026. This process employed a selective procurement method through a call-off from a framework agreement.

## Notice

The programme aims to deliver fundamental reforms to imaging and pathology services driving up quality, enabling workforce optimisation, increased productivity and a reduction in regional and local variations that can affect the health outcomes for individuals. The service will provide technical architecture expertise to progress pilot testing with a small number of identified Trusts. This will include the development and analysis of prototype models, testing the assumptions and focusing on the challenging areas in order to provide a deeper understanding of the ease of integration, costs required, any immovable constraints/boundaries and risk. Those deployed to the service must have rich experience in the deployment of solutions at a national scale and also deep technical expertise in diagnostics and integration such as gateways.
